There are several AI Ships that contain BMP files! Do you need to convert these to DDS files for these boats to be displayed correctly?

I believe that is a yes,  but I'm not positive.

But,  you have to watch how you save them as DDS.   Like I said,  DXT1 doesn't save an alpha channel.   Alpha channels define transparency.   I think DXT3 or DXT5,  do save the alpha channel,  but I'm not really educated in this.

I know I converted the HMS Bounty using the DXT1 setting,  but some parts of the model don't show the textures correctly.   I think I need to use one of the formats that does save the alpha channel instead of DXT1.

Can someone PLEASE put in simple terms how to convert the AI Ship package to MSFS.  Can you give me SIMPLE step by step instructions.  What I consider a success is just to see a ship object in the sim.  I do not care about wakes or landing platforms - just give me some moving ships.

Thank you very much!

Kodiakman

AS it is described above in the posts :

 

After downloading and extracting the mentioned collection properly to your community folder; please also download the MSFSLayoutGenerator.exe from this link https://github.com/HughesMDflyer4/MSFSLayoutGenerator/releases , and put it in the same folder with the collection. Then grab any layout.json and manifest.json files from any of your existing addons (no problem which one they are) and put them in he same folder. Lastly, take only your layout.json file and place it onto MSFSLayoutGenerator.exe  file which will convert your layout.json file to the one you need automatically. That is it. Then run your simulator. All is there. (Do not forget that all the above files must be in the same folder to generate properly.)

I'd open the manifest in notepad and change the info.   Here's what I did,

Quote

{
  "dependencies": [],
  "content_type": "SCENERY",
  "title": "Global AI Ship Traffic V2",
  "manufacturer": "Henrik Nielsen",
  "creator": "Henrik Nielsen",
  "package_version": "FSX/P3d Port-over",
  "minimum_game_version": "1.9.5",
  "release_notes": {
    "neutral": {
      "LastUpdate": "",
      "OlderHistory": ""
    }
  }
}
